description | Large classes of AdSp supergravity backgrounds describing the IR dynamics of p-branes wrapped on a Riemann surface are determined by a solution
to the Liouville equation. The regular solutions of this equation lead to the
well-known wrapped brane supergravity solutions associated with the constant
curvature metric on a compact Riemann surface. We show that some singular solutions of the Liouville equation have a physical interpretation as explicit
point-like brane sources on the Riemann surface. We uncover the details of this
picture by focusing on $\mathcal{N}$ = 1 theories of class $\mathcal{S}$ arising from M5-branes on a
punctured Riemann surface. We present explicit AdS5 solutions dual to these
SCFTs and check the holographic duality by showing the non-trivial agreement
of ’t Hooft anomalies.
